sql >> Database >  >> RDS >> Mysql

Afstand in meters tussen twee ruimtelijke punten in MySQL-query

Merk op dat in MySql de volgorde van de coördinaten is:
1. POINT(lng, lat) - geen SRID
2. ST_GeomFromText('POINT(lat lng)', 4326) - met SRID

select st_distance_sphere(POINT(-73.9949,40.7501), POINT( -73.9961,40.7542)) 

zal 466.9696023582369 retourneren, zoals verwacht, en 466.9696023582369> 300 natuurlijk



  1. Wat is databasetesten en hoe voer je het uit?

  2. Door komma's gescheiden waarden met SQL Query

  3. lege string in orakel

  4. MySQL Workbench verbreekt verbinding bij inactiviteit